I couldn't pay a bodyman $3K in bodywork and add the risk of corrosion problems down the road for some cosmetics. I think the black tape is kinda' cheezy, however, I'd do that before hacking up my car. In addition, I'm sure there are additional structural and crash protection panels in those areas, like the inner and outer wheelhouses and such (I worked at a dealership and bodyshop for ten years, so yes, I know what could be there...) These are likely one of the many reasons the fuel tank filler door was moved also. It's not as easy as some think, to do this kinda' metalwork correctly. If you wanted a flawless job, you'd paint almost both sides of the car to achieve a good blendable color match; the front doors for sure. Some will argue, but this is not an easy proposition.
